WebJoshua (born Hoshea; Heb.:"salvation") was the son of Nun, of the Tribe of Ephraim. He was an Israelite leader in Ephraim who was selected as successor of Moses by God. He served as an aide to Moses during the 40 years of journeying through the wilderness. the philistines playWebApr 5, 2009 · Joshua died when he was 110 years old. Only one other patriarchal figure lived exactly to 110: Joseph. And the Book of Joshua connects these two leaders in the final lines of the book.
